Spectacular Northern lights, moutain views and a laid back slow paced small town experience is what you can expect in Norman Wells! Norman Wells is a small town in the Northwest Territories along the Mackenzie River that offers a great sense of community and family. Norman Wells is a small community with opportunity for participating in a variety of workshops offered throughout the year to do things like learn traditional beading, sewing, drum making, jelly and tea making among other things. You can get a gym membership, join a hockey team, go skating or drop in to join a basketball or volleyball game at the school gym if you are interested. There is cross country skiing and curling. In the winter there is only a few hours of daylight and in the spring / summer only a few hours of dark. It's quite amazing to experience both! In May everyone looks forward to river break up where huge chunks of candlestick ice pushes up onto shore off the Mackenzie river.I have been a stay at home mom since having my first son 8 years ago and I am looking forward to getting back to work, but only if I can find someone who is enthusiatic about living in the north.
